History has been made on your birthday. The following are important historical events that occurred on April 6
Year | Event |
---|---|
402 | Stilicho defeats the Visigoths under Alaric in the Battle of Pollentia. |
1320 | The Scots reaffirm their independence by signing the Declaration of Arbroath. |
1453 | Mehmed II begins his siege of Constantinople. The city falls on May 29, and is renamed Istanbul. |
1580 | One of the largest earthquakes recorded in the history of England, Flanders, or Northern France, takes place. |
1652 | At the Cape of Good Hope, Dutch sailor Jan van Riebeeck establishes a resupply camp that eventually becomes Cape Town. |
1712 | The New York Slave Revolt of 1712 begins near Broadway. |
1776 | American Revolutionary War: Ships of the Continental Navy fail in their attempt to capture a Royal Navy dispatch boat. |
1782 | King Buddha Yodfa Chulaloke (Rama I) of Siam (modern day Thailand) establishes the Chakri dynasty. |
1793 | During the French Revolution, the Committee of Public Safety becomes the executive organ of the republic. |
1800 | The Treaty of Constantinople establishes the Septinsular Republic, the first autonomous Greek state since the Fall of the Byzantine Empire. (Under the Old Style calendar then still in use in the Ottoman Empire, the treaty was signed on 21 March.) |
In 1974,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, Michael is the most used. A total of 67,580 baby boys were named Michael in 1974. The rest were named Jason, Christopher, David and James. While the popular baby girl name in 1974 was Jennifer. There were 63,116 baby girls named Jennifer that year. While the rest were named Amy, Michelle, Heather and Angela.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
